The volume of cuboid is $900 \mathrm{~cm}^{3}$ and its length is $15 \mathrm{~cm}$ and height is $12 \mathrm{~cm}$, then find its breadth.

(a) $5 \mathrm{~cm}$

(b) $7 \mathrm{~cm}$

(c) $6 \mathrm{~cm}$

(d) $30 \mathrm{~cm}$

Solution

Breadth of the cuboid

$$

\begin{array}{l}

=\frac{\text { Volume }}{l \times h} \\

=\frac{900}{15 \times 12} \\

=5 \mathrm{~cm} ; \text { Ans. }

\end{array}

$$

$\therefore$ Correct option is $( a) $
